Materials: Maintain Reagents and buffers at 4°C.

  1. Fluorochrome-conjugated primary antibody
  2. Fluorochrome-conjugated isotype control antibody
  3. Fixation Buffer, ADI-950-011
  4. PBS (Phosphate Buffered Saline), OmniPur 6505
  5. FBS (Fetal Bovine Serum), Gibco 10082
  6. 10 x 75 mm Tubes, VWR 60818-281

Procedure:

  1. Harvest N x 106 cells and wash twice in 20 ml of PBS followed by centrifugation at 400 x g for 7 minutes (N=number of samples to be tested +1 for each isotype control).
  2. Re-suspend cells in N x 1 ml of Fixation Buffer.
  3. Mix well by inverting and incubate for 30 minutes at 4°C.
  4. Mix well by inverting and centrifuge at 400 x g for 7 minutes.
  5. Decant supernatant and resuspend cells in N x 1 ml of PBS.
  6. Centrifuge at 400 x g for 7 minutes.
  7. Decant supernatant and resuspend pellet in N x 50 µl of PBS.
  8. Gently mix by pipette and aliquot the cell suspension in 50 µl aliquots.
  9. Add the appropriate amount of antibody, to the cell aliquots, to achieve the target working concentration.
  10. Gently mix by pipette and incubate for 30 minutes in the dark at 4°C.
  11. Wash by adding 1 ml of PBS.
  12. Gently mix by pipette and centrifuge at 400 x g for 7 minutes.
  13. Decant supernatant and wash in 1 ml of PBS.
  14. Gently mix by pipette and centrifuge at 400 x g for 7 minutes.
  15. Decant supernatant and gently resuspend cell pellet by pipette with 500 µl of PBS containing 1% FBS. Evaluate cell staining on flow cytometer.
